Savoy Cabbage Chop Roll

The perfect savoy cabbage chop roll recipe with a picture and simple step-by-step instructions.

  • 1 piece Savoy
  • 500 g Mixed minced meat
  • 1 piece Bun old
  • 1 piece Onion
  • 1 toe Garlic fresh
  • 0,5 piece Red pepper
  • 100 g Feta cheese
  • 1 tablespoon Garlic mustard
  • 1 teaspoon Tomato paste
  • 1 piece Egg
  • 1 Teaspoon (level) Sweet paprika powder
  • Sea salt from the mill to taste
  • Milled pepper to taste
  1. Dismantle the sausage in the leaves, wash and remove the stalk. Bring about 3 liters of water to a boil in a large saucepan. Put the savoy cabbage leaves in the boiling water for 1 minute, remove, rinse immediately in a large bowl with cold water and drain in a sieve.
  2. Soak the rolls in water or milk and squeeze them out. Finely dice / chop the onion, garlic and paprika. Crumble the feta cheese. Mix everything together with the egg, mustard, tomato paste, paprika powder, salt and pepper and knead with the minced meat.
  3. Spread the pearling leaves on a baking mat and distribute the minced meat on top. Roll up as in the photo and place in a lightly oiled baking dish. Use an oil sprayer to spray some oil on the chopping roller. Bake / roast in a preheated oven at 175 ° C for approx. 45 – 60 minutes until golden brown.
